Ikoo, the largest advertising network in the Middle East and North Africa, has signed a series of exclusive contracts with new publishers and partners. This network expansion will add to the extensive portfolio of publishers that consists of more than 120 websites.

With year-on-year sales that have doubled over the first two months of 2010, Ikoo has set out to capitalise on its success by taking on the role of sole media representative for leading Saudi dailies Al-Riyadh (alriyadh.net) and Okaz (okaz.com.sa), in addition to tdwl.net, aljamaheir.net, alrams.net, and sohbanet.com.

Since its launch in 2005, Ikoo has been busy establishing premium partnerships with the region's leading portals and top publishers. Today, it attracts over 35 million users, serving more than 1.4 billion monthly pageviews. These make it ideal for advertisers looking to reach the maximum possible audience through themed sub-networks including sport, automotive, women, news, social media and business.

Both Al-Riyadh and Okaz are among the top print newspapers in Saudi Arabia, and having both of their online offerings as partners can only enhance Ikoo's network among top publishers, not only in the Kingdom but across the region.

Meanwhile, tdwl.net is at its peak as a financial website, and adds a further string to Ikoo's bow in this important field. And Ikoo's partnership with sohbanet.com, alrams.net and aljamaheir.net show how the advertising network is prepared to diversify its portfolio throughout the Gulf and Arab world.

Across each of these properties — part of a its portfolio of over 120 web sites — Ikoo has exclusive rights to certain advertising units. This range will enable it to use its status as sole media representative to manage the best possible placements.

Meanwhile, a further agreement — for two years — with the region's premier digital media planning platform, Effective Measure, brings with it a transparent system for advertisers and publishers that will further fuel online advertising spending and growth. With the increased demand for digital advertising in the region, Effective Measure's measurement tools have become necessary for planning intelligent online advertising campaigns.
